Adt là gì

     

Tôi hiện giờ đang nghiên cứu và phân tích về các loại dữ liệu trừu tượng (ADT) tuy thế tôi hoàn toàn thiếu hiểu biết nhiều định nghĩa này. Ai đó có thể vui vẻ phân tích và lý giải mang lại tôi phần đa gì đích thực là gì? Trong khi bộ sưu tập, túi cùng Danh sách ADT là gì? Nói một phương pháp đối kháng giản? 


Kiểu dữ liệu trừu tượng (ADT) là dạng hình dữ liệu, trong các số ấy chỉ hành động được xác định tuy vậy không tiến hành. 

Đối diện cùng với ADT là Kiểu tài liệu ví dụ (CDT), trong số ấy nó đựng một xúc tiến ADT. 

Ví dụ: Array, List, Map, Queue, Set, Staông xã, Table, Tree, & Vector là những ADT. Mỗi ADT này có nhiều thực thi, có nghĩa là CDT. Container là 1 trong những ADT cao cấp trên toàn bộ các ADT.

Bạn đang xem: Adt là gì

lấy ví dụ như thực tế: cuốn sách là Tóm tắt (Sách điện thoại cảm ứng là một trong những triển khai) 

*


Kiểu dữ liệu Abstact Wikipedia có khá nhiều điều nhằm nói.

Trong kỹ thuật máy tính xách tay, một đẳng cấp dữ liệu trừu tượng (ADT) là 1 trong những mô hình tân oán học cho một lớp cấu trúc tài liệu khăng khăng bao gồm hành động tương tự; hoặc đến một vài các loại dữ liệu khăng khăng của một hoặc những ngôn ngữ lập trình sẵn có ngữ nghĩa tương tự. Một thứ hạng tài liệu trừu tượng được khái niệm một phương pháp loại gián tiếp, chỉ bởi các hoạt động có thể được triển khai trên nó với vày những ràng buộc toán thù học tập về các hiệu ứng (và rất có thể là chi phí) của các vận động kia.

Nói một biện pháp cụ thể hơn, chúng ta có thể đem hình ảnh List của Java làm cho ví dụ. Giao diện trọn vẹn ko xác minh bất kỳ hành vi nào do không có lớp List cụ thể. Giao diện hướng đẫn nghĩa một tập hợp những cách làm nhưng mà những lớp không giống (ví dụ: ArrayList cùng LinkedList ) đề nghị thực hiện để được xem là List.

Xem thêm: Bài Văn Mẫu Thuyết Minh Về Nguyễn Du Và Truyện Kiều (11 Mẫu)

Collection là 1 trong những kiểu dữ liệu trừu tượng khác. Trong trường hợp bối cảnh Collection của Java, nó thậm chí còn còn trừu tượng rộng List, Tính từ lúc khi 

Giao diện List đặt các khí cụ bổ sung, kế bên các giải pháp được chỉ định vào bối cảnh Collection, bên trên các hợp đồng của các cách tiến hành iterator, add, remove sầu, equals cùng hashCode.

Một túi còn được gọi là a multiset .

Trong tân oán học tập, định nghĩa multiphối (hoặc túi) là một bao hàm của tư tưởng tập đúng theo trong đó các member được phnghiền xuất hiện những lần. Ví dụ: gồm một tập hợp duy nhất cất những bộ phận a cùng b với không tồn tại bộ phận nào không giống, tuy vậy có khá nhiều tập hợp với thuộc tính này, ví dụ như tập vừa lòng gồm nhì bản sao của a cùng một trong số b hoặc những tập bao gồm chứa bố bản sao của tất cả A và B.

Xem thêm: Cách Chơi Free Fire Trên Pc Bluestacks, Gameloop, Nox, Cách Chơi Garena Free Fire Trên Pc Với Bluestacks

Trong Java, Bag đã là 1 trong những bộ sưu tập tiến hành bối cảnh cực kỳ đơn giản và dễ dàng. quý khách chỉ cần phải có thể thêm những mặt hàng vào một chiếc túi, soát sổ kích cỡ của chính nó và lặp đi tái diễn bên trên các món đồ cơ mà nó chứa. Xem Bag.Java nhằm biết cách tiến hành ví dụ (từ bỏ Sedgewiông xã & Wayne"s Thuật toán thù phiên bản trang bị 4 ).


Chuyên mục: Tài chính